Visual Indicators of Termite Invasion
If you notice small piles of what resembles sawdust near wooden frameworks in your house, you may be seeing the very first visual indications of a termite invasion. As you check your home for indications of termites, pay very close attention to any kind of mud tubes leaving the wall surfaces or foundation. These tubes function as protective passages for termites to travel in between their nest and a food resource without drying. Additionally, keep an eye out for any bubbling or peeling paint, as this might show wetness accumulation brought on by termite activity within the wall surfaces.
To better validate a termite invasion, look for hollow-sounding timber when tapped and check for any disposed of wings near windowsills or door frameworks. Taking punctual activity upon observing these aesthetic signs can assist avoid comprehensive damage to your home.
Auditory Clues to Expect
When listening for acoustic ideas of termite task in your house, pay attention to any kind of faint hitting or tapping sounds originating from the walls or wooden frameworks. These sounds are usually an indication of termites at work within the timber, biting away and triggering damage. While these noises may be refined and easy to miss out on, specifically during the day when there's even more ambient noise, try listening throughout the quiet of the night to detect any unusual audios that could suggest termite visibility.
If you listen to these faint noises, it's essential to examine additional to determine the resource and degree of the prospective termite infestation. By capturing the trouble early, you can stop substantial damages and pricey repair services down the line. Structural Changes Triggered By Termites
Listen closely for any type of indications of hollow-sounding or deteriorated wood in your house, as these structural modifications could show a termite infestation. Termites feed on timber from the inside out, leaving a slim veneer of lumber or paint on the surface while burrowing the inside. This can result in timber that appears hollow when tapped or really feels soft and compromised.
Additionally, you may discover twisting or sagging floors, doors that no more close effectively, or windows that are instantly challenging to open up. These modifications take place as termites damage the structural integrity of wood aspects in your house. Watch out for tiny openings in timber, as these could be termite departure points where they push out fecal pellets.
If you observe any one of these architectural changes, it's vital to act quickly and seek specialist aid to evaluate and deal with a prospective termite infestation prior to it causes additional damage to your home.
